The Manual Backwash Filter Market grew from USD 425.28 million in 2025 to USD 460.36 million in 2026. It is expected to continue growing at a CAGR of 7.00%, reaching USD 682.94 million by 2032.

Manual backwash filters are evolving into reliability-critical assets as industries prioritize uptime, protect downstream equipment, and stabilize variable water quality

Manual backwash filters remain a foundational technology for removing suspended solids in industrial and municipal fluid systems where operators need a robust, serviceable solution without the complexity or power demands of fully automatic self-cleaning architectures. Their relevance has grown as plants pursue tighter process control, protect downstream assets such as pumps and membranes, and manage variable water quality that increasingly reflects climate-driven turbidity swings, intermittent storm events, and changing source-water blends.

Across water and wastewater, industrial utilities, and process industries, the value proposition is practical: maintain flow continuity while enabling periodic cleaning through a controlled reversal of flow or targeted flushing, typically initiated by an operator or a simple pressure-drop trigger. That simplicity is often the deciding factor in remote sites, budget-constrained facilities, and applications where maintenance teams prefer mechanical transparency over sensor-heavy automation. At the same time, the “manual” label does not imply outdated design. Current offerings frequently integrate improved screen geometries, corrosion-resistant alloys, better sealing systems, and modular housings that reduce downtime when strainers or screens are serviced.

As this executive summary sets the stage, it focuses on the competitive and operational dynamics shaping adoption: the modernization of critical infrastructure, the rising cost of unplanned outages, and the need to standardize filtration performance across multi-site footprints. These drivers elevate manual backwash filters from a commodity accessory to a reliability component that procurement, operations, and engineering teams increasingly evaluate through total cost of ownership, maintainability, and supply continuity.

Design priorities are shifting toward maintainability, corrosion resilience, instrumentation readiness, and supply-chain-friendly modular platforms across end users

The landscape for manual backwash filters is undergoing several transformative shifts, beginning with a stronger emphasis on reliability engineering and maintenance standardization. Rather than treating filtration as a late-stage add-on, project teams are specifying filters earlier in the design cycle to reduce lifecycle risk. This shift is visible in the way end users ask for clearer fouling indicators, more predictable pressure-loss curves, and service access that fits established maintenance routines. Consequently, manufacturers are refining housing designs, quick-open closures, and screen retention mechanisms to shorten service windows and minimize operator exposure to contaminated media.

In parallel, material science and surface engineering are changing product expectations. Corrosion resistance is no longer limited to premium segments; it is increasingly a baseline requirement in applications exposed to aggressive chemistries, brackish water, or cleaning regimes that use oxidants. This pushes broader adoption of stainless steels, duplex grades, and engineered polymers, alongside improved coatings for carbon-steel bodies. The result is an expanding middle ground where buyers can achieve longer service intervals without moving entirely to automated systems.

Another shift is the convergence of manual systems with light-touch monitoring. While the backwash actuation may remain manual, buyers often want instrumentation-ready ports and compatibility with differential pressure gauges, simple switches, or plant historian inputs. This “manual-plus” configuration supports data-informed maintenance without the capital and operational burden of full automation. It is especially relevant for multi-site operators trying to standardize maintenance triggers and document compliance.

Finally, procurement and supply chains are exerting a greater influence on product choice. Lead times for castings, specialty alloys, and large-diameter components have made availability a design constraint. As a result, buyers are qualifying secondary suppliers, insisting on interchangeable screen elements, and favoring modular platforms that can be built with regionally available materials. This procurement-led design approach is reshaping how manufacturers position product lines, emphasizing platform commonality and service parts continuity as competitive differentiators.

US tariff conditions in 2025 are reshaping sourcing, material selection, pricing discipline, and spare-parts strategies for manual backwash filters

United States tariff dynamics moving into 2025 are expected to amplify cost and sourcing complexity for manual backwash filters, particularly where supply chains rely on imported steel, stainless components, cast housings, fasteners, or fabricated subassemblies. Even when a filter is assembled domestically, upstream exposure to tariff-affected inputs can translate into higher bill-of-materials costs and more frequent price adjustments, challenging buyers that rely on annual contracts or fixed-price project bids.

One of the most significant impacts is the acceleration of supplier requalification. Engineering and procurement teams are spending more time validating alternate foundries, machine shops, and screen-media suppliers to reduce exposure to sudden duty changes or port delays. This requalification effort is not merely administrative; it can affect performance consistency when screen weave, perforation tolerances, or welding quality varies by supplier. Consequently, buyers are asking for tighter documentation around material traceability, pressure testing, and repeatable manufacturing processes.

Tariffs can also influence product architecture decisions. In applications where higher-alloy materials are preferred for corrosion resistance, the tariff-driven premium on imported stainless grades may encourage a redesign toward optimized wall thickness, localized reinforcement, or selective use of higher-grade materials only where most needed. Conversely, in less aggressive environments, some buyers may shift to coated carbon steel or engineered polymers to balance durability with cost. These substitution strategies increase the importance of clear chemical compatibility guidance and transparent service-life assumptions.

Operationally, the tariff environment encourages more disciplined spare-parts planning. Facilities that previously ordered screens, seals, and gaskets on demand are increasingly building minimum on-site inventories to protect uptime. That, in turn, affects how suppliers bundle service kits and how they manage aftermarket availability. Over time, the market advantage will favor manufacturers that can offer stable pricing frameworks, domestic or regional manufacturing options, and well-documented equivalency for components sourced from multiple countries.

Segmentation shows buying decisions diverge by filter type, screen media, size, end-use requirements, and channel dynamics that shape lifecycle cost

Key segmentation patterns reveal that purchasing behavior is shaped by how operators balance simplicity, cleaning frequency, and the risk tolerance for downtime. By type, buyers differentiate between manual backwash filters designed for straightforward periodic flushing and more rugged configurations intended for higher solids loads, where screen geometry and internal flow paths are engineered to reduce blinding. This type-based distinction often correlates with whether the site can tolerate short flow interruptions and how consistently operators can execute backwash routines.

By filtration media and screen construction, the market divides along performance and serviceability expectations. Wedge wire and perforated screens tend to appeal to operators who prioritize mechanical robustness and easier cleaning, particularly in water with fibrous debris or variable particle size. Fine mesh solutions are selected where capture efficiency must be higher, but they also require more disciplined maintenance and can be more sensitive to upstream upsets. These trade-offs directly influence operating cost, because a marginal improvement in capture can translate into more frequent cleaning cycles or faster pressure rise.

By size and flow capacity, the segmentation reflects the difference between compact, equipment-protection installations and larger, process-line deployments. Smaller units are commonly installed as point-of-use protection for pumps, heat exchangers, and nozzles, where the objective is to prevent immediate damage. Larger-diameter filters are tied to plant-level intake and recirculation loops where service access, lifting requirements, and bypass design become critical. As size increases, buyers pay closer attention to body construction, flange standards, and screen replacement logistics because maintenance complexity scales quickly.

By end-use industry, requirements diverge sharply. Municipal water and wastewater operators focus on reliability, operator safety, and straightforward compliance documentation, while industrial users often prioritize process continuity and equipment protection under harsher operating conditions. Chemical processing and oil and gas environments place outsized weight on material compatibility and pressure ratings, whereas food and beverage users emphasize hygienic design, cleanability, and surface finish expectations when filters contact product streams. Agriculture and irrigation applications tend to favor ruggedness and low service complexity, especially where staffing is limited and water quality fluctuates.

By distribution channel and buying center, the segmentation highlights a split between engineered project procurement and maintenance-driven replacement demand. Direct sales and EPC-led specifications dominate larger installations, where documentation, drawings, and commissioning support matter. Distributor-led routes perform strongly where speed of availability and local service support drive decisions, particularly for standardized sizes. Across both channels, aftermarket screens and seal kits are increasingly strategic, because consistent service parts availability can be the deciding factor when two filters appear similar on initial specifications.

Regional adoption patterns reflect infrastructure renewal, water scarcity pressures, industrial growth, and serviceability needs across diverse operating contexts

Regional dynamics underscore that adoption is influenced as much by operating context as by technology. In the Americas, replacement demand and infrastructure renewal are prominent themes, with users emphasizing dependable delivery, standardized parts, and service support across geographically dispersed assets. Industrial facilities often prioritize protecting high-value downstream equipment, while municipal operators focus on straightforward operation and clear maintenance documentation to meet internal reliability targets.

In Europe, Middle East & Africa, regulatory expectations and water scarcity considerations shape filtration priorities. European buyers commonly emphasize energy efficiency across the broader system, driving interest in low pressure-drop designs and repeatable cleaning outcomes that reduce pumping penalties. In the Middle East, desalination-adjacent and industrial reuse environments elevate the need for corrosion-resistant materials and consistent performance under high salinity or challenging source-water conditions. Across parts of Africa, ruggedness and serviceability can outweigh advanced features, particularly where remote operations and limited access to specialized spare parts favor mechanically transparent designs.

In Asia-Pacific, industrial expansion, urban infrastructure investment, and high variability in raw water quality support a broad range of use cases. Fast-moving industrial projects frequently look for scalable platforms that can be deployed across sites with consistent documentation and training requirements. At the same time, high-density urban areas and water reuse initiatives increase attention to pretreatment reliability, because filtration stability reduces downstream operational disruptions. Supply chain localization is especially relevant in this region, where buyers may evaluate domestic manufacturing capability and the availability of standardized consumables to mitigate lead-time risk.

Across all regions, a common thread is the shift toward resilience. Owners are increasingly designing systems to handle variability in source quality, seasonal loading, and operational upsets. This raises the value of filters that maintain predictable performance, provide clear indications for cleaning, and offer straightforward service workflows regardless of site maturity or staffing depth.

Company differentiation is sharpening around configurable platforms, validated application guidance, quality traceability, and strong aftermarket service ecosystems

Competitive positioning among key companies increasingly centers on platform breadth, documentation quality, and lifecycle support rather than headline filtration claims alone. Manufacturers that offer multiple housing materials, screen options, and connection standards are better positioned to serve both engineered projects and maintenance replacements without forcing buyers into custom designs. This breadth becomes particularly important when global operators seek to standardize filtration across plants while still meeting local code requirements and fluid compatibility constraints.

Another differentiator is how effectively suppliers translate application complexity into selection confidence. Companies that provide clear guidance on pressure drop behavior, solids loading tolerance, and cleaning procedure validation help buyers avoid overspecification and reduce commissioning friction. In practice, this includes better drawings, clearer installation envelopes, and repeatable test documentation that supports internal quality systems. As procurement teams demand traceability, suppliers with mature quality control and consistent manufacturing processes gain credibility in critical service applications.

Aftermarket strength is also separating leaders from followers. Reliable availability of replacement screens, seals, and service kits, along with clear part numbering and cross-reference support, reduces downtime and improves customer retention. Additionally, companies that invest in field service training, distributor enablement, and practical troubleshooting resources are gaining influence in maintenance-led buying cycles. Over time, the ability to support the installed base with predictable lead times and consistent component interchangeability will remain a primary driver of repeat business.

Finally, customization capability remains relevant, but it is shifting toward configurable modularity rather than one-off engineering. Buyers want options such as alternate drain arrangements, instrument ports, bypass configurations, and quick-open closures without introducing long lead times. Companies that can deliver configurable products while keeping manufacturing repeatable are likely to sustain margin discipline and improve responsiveness under volatile supply conditions.

Leaders can win on reliability and cost by standardizing specifications, optimizing materials, building resilient sourcing, and modernizing maintenance discipline

Industry leaders can strengthen performance and profitability by treating manual backwash filters as part of a reliability program rather than a discrete component purchase. Standardizing selection criteria across sites is a practical first step. When engineering teams define consistent thresholds for allowable pressure drop, cleaning triggers, and screen replacement intervals, procurement can reduce variability, simplify spares, and improve supplier negotiations without compromising performance.

Next, leaders should align material choices with real operating exposure, not generic specifications. A disciplined compatibility review that considers cleaning chemicals, temperature excursions, and upset conditions often reveals where premium alloys are essential and where cost-effective alternatives will perform reliably. This approach also reduces the risk of premature corrosion, screen deformation, or seal failure that can turn a low-cost purchase into a high-cost outage.

Supply chain resilience should be addressed through dual sourcing and parts strategy. Qualifying at least one alternate supplier for critical elements such as screens and seals helps protect uptime when tariffs, logistics delays, or capacity constraints emerge. At the plant level, stocking policies should be tied to criticality and lead-time variability, with service kits defined in a way that matches actual maintenance practice rather than theoretical replacement schedules.

Finally, leaders should modernize operational discipline without forcing full automation. Adding differential pressure indication, instrument-ready connections, and simple maintenance logging can materially improve cleaning consistency and asset life. When sites capture basic performance indicators and link them to maintenance events, they can optimize backwash frequency, reduce water waste during cleaning, and document operational controls for internal audits. This pragmatic blend of mechanical simplicity and data visibility is often the fastest path to measurable reliability gains.
